No not really. The religious people usually only believe in one divinity, God (or group of gods). And if their basis of belief is in the Bible, the bible specifically mentions avoiding practicers of divinity, fortune tellers and witchcraft. An easy way of avoiding them is to not lend them any weight or credibility (despite the fact that very few can actually back up their claim to be psychic). Most psychics are involved in spiritism, rather than spirituality. Spiritism is the belief that the dead can communicate with the living and therefore they attribute their ability to these spirits. Spirituality is pertaining to sacred things or matters; religious; devotional; sacred. The two are completely different to the religious community. A Spiritual person (or religious person) would avoid spiritism since it is biblically related to the things that God hates. Many consider these spirits of dead ones to be nothing more than demons impersonating loved ones to seem more acceptable to people. Though some may think that psychics are as fraudulant as the concept of God and thus group them together in the same catagory, it doesn't work in reverse, they do not catagorize together at all.
